Job Description:

TD Securities (TDS) Governance & Control (G&C) team partners with the TDS businesses globally to design implement maintain and monitor effective internal controls and ensure business activities remain within TD Banks risk appetite and comply with external regulatory requirements.

The team is responsible for ensuring timely and consistent implementation across all TDS businesses of all risk control and governance programs initiatives policies and strategic business projects. The TDS G&C team acts as the primary contact for the TDS businesses working closely with subject matter experts from each TDS business line. The team works together with the business leaders to implement TDS G&C methodologies policy frameworks standards and practices and are key members of enterprise projects / programs requiring TDS representation.

Job Description

Reporting to the Manager TDS G&C the primary role of the Senior Analyst TDS G&C support all TDS businesses in adherence to regulatory and enterprise requirements managing non-financial risk and ensuring effective controls in place.

The key accountabilities of the Senior Analyst role are as follows:

  • Assist with creation and maintenance of Value Chain (VC) Assessable Unit (AU) and Unique Business Process (UBP) inventories
  • Perform Risk and Control Self-Assessment (RCSA) documentation and engage other risk partners in RCSA execution.
  • Assess multiple individual processes concurrently consolidate risks and controls across processes to eliminate duplication and identify any gaps in processes as well as process inventory.
  • Assist with RCSA interim updates as operational risk events/issues arise
  • Identify and recommend opportunities to automate enhance or streamline controls and any other processes.
  • Ensure that exceptions are appropriately analyzed reported and tracked to resolution. Further support TDS Businesses in developing action/remediation plans to address internal control gaps as well as the root cause themes.
  • Identify opportunities to improve processes realize efficiencies in testing (where possible) and deliver a better testing experience to TDS Businesses.
  • Assist with ad-hoc initiatives and strategies from a risk and control perspective.
  • Contribute to and promote positive working relationships by effectively communicating and regularly sharing information issues/points of interest learnings and knowledge with the team.

Who We Are:

TD Securities offers a wide range of capital markets products and services to corporate government and institutional clients who choose us for our innovation execution and experience. With more than 6500 professionals operating out of 40 cities across the globe we strive to make every interaction product and experience remarkably human and refreshingly simple. Our services include underwriting and distributing new issues providing trusted advice and industry-leading insight extending access to global markets and delivering integrated transaction banking 2023 we acquired Cowen Inc. offering our clients access to a premier U.S. equities business and highly-diverse equity research franchise while growing our strong diversified investment bank.

Together we are reimagining what banking can be for our clients colleagues and communities.
